Pond Excavation in Atlanta, GA
Pond excavation services involve the removal, reshaping, or creation of ponds on residential properties. This process is often requested for projects such as installing new ponds, enlarging existing water features, or preparing land for landscaping and drainage improvements.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of excavation work, including how it impacts their landscape and the necessary steps to ensure proper water management and aesthetic appeal.
Before requesting pond excavation, homeowners should consider factors like the size and depth of the pond, the type of soil and terrain, and any local regulations or permits that may be required. It’s also helpful to evaluate the purpose of the pond, whether for aesthetic enhancement, wildlife habitat, or irrigation, to ensure the excavation plan aligns with those goals. Clear communication about project expectations and site conditions can facilitate a smooth excavation process.

Common Pond Excavation Jobs
Pond Construction - creating new ponds to enhance landscape features and provide outdoor enjoyment.
Dam and Spillway Installation - building structures to control water flow and prevent flooding.
Drainage System Excavation - improving water runoff and preventing water accumulation around properties.
Pond Repair and Restoration - fixing leaks, erosion, or structural issues in existing ponds.
Sediment and Debris Removal - clearing out accumulated materials to maintain pond health and function.
Water Feature Excavation - installing fountains, waterfalls, and other decorative water elements.
Pond Excavation Questions
What types of ponds can be excavated? Excavation services typically accommodate various pond types, including decorative, fish, and retention ponds, tailored to property needs.
Why is pond excavation important? Proper excavation ensures the pond’s structural stability, proper water flow, and longevity for landscaping or water management purposes.
What is involved in the excavation process? The process generally includes site assessment, digging to the desired depth and shape, and preparing the area for lining or other features.
What should property owners consider before excavation? It’s important to evaluate site conditions, drainage, and future use plans to ensure the pond meets long-term needs.
